One of our clients of the clinic in santo domingo was robbed in the day time, right at her secured home.
here is how it went:
He phone service got suddenly disconnected for no apparent reason. She calls codetel and she is promised that some one will come to check her line in 2-5 working days. To her surprise, codetel technicians came the same day. She was so happy to see them come and restore her line and internet service. She let them in through the gate and doors, just to find out, they were not from codetel. Guns were pulled out and the rich lady was robbed clean of all her valuables. Turns out, these guys were the same people who were responsible for cutting off her phone wires outside.
So there you have it, new trick.

Ask the repair men for the report number

And I feel robbed every month by the genuine Codetel!!

This is timely because I had a service outage this week after returning from a trip the phone was down, but the Internet was still up. Fortunately they fixed the problem without a need to visit my property.

One way to protect yourself is to ask the repair men for the report number you received from Codetel. If they cannot tell you that number do not let them in.

The first thing that any Codetel technician would do would check the integrity of the line out in front of the street first.

Therefore, if some Codetel guy wants to come inside the house immediately be suspicious and call the Codetel line to see if they had been dispatched to your house.

I also doubt any thief would want to call attention to others in the neighborhood by going up a pole because he never knows who might be coming by, like a real Codetel technician - and they all know eachother that work in the same sector - so by default I expect them to immediately try to get into the property after arriving.

If they are from Codetel they would be driving one of the Codetel trucks they use all the time. Just look for that before even considering letting anyone in.
